Toxicology Analyst

Organization Name: 
PremierTox

The candidate will be responsible primarily for performance of highly complex scientific analyses, technical duties to include operation, maintenance and troubleshooting of multiple LC-tandem MS instrumentation, performance of quantitative and qualitative drug analyses to include liquid/liquid and solid phase extractions, and data review. Additional technical duties may include certification of final results, quality control and quality assurance, assist with instrumentation maintenance, and participation in new method development and validation.

This position is for our lab located in Russell Springs, Kentucky.

Qualifications: 

Req Experience: 1 year experience using LC/MS/MS required;
3- 5 years experience in Toxicology preferred

Req Education: Bachelor's degree in one of the natural sciences in Biology, Chemistry, Pharmacology, or Toxicology, or Medical Technology; or, training and experience comparable to a Bachelor's in one of the natural sciences.

AAFS MISSION

The American Academy of Forensic Sciences is a multi-disciplinary professional organization that provides leadership to advance science and its application to the legal system. The objectives of the Academy are to promote professionalism, integrity, competency, education, foster research, improve practice, and encourage collaboration in the forensic sciences.
